64.9 F
Storrs
Wednesday, June 7, 2023

attachment-5a78ff5b24a694819ece66ab

img-5a78ff5b24a694819ece66ab

attachment-5a7900e7ec212de7dd858583
attachment-5a78f3dd24a694819ecb77dc